Two slashed in Upper West Side brawl

Wednesday, September 12, 2007

A bloody brawl in Manhattan on Wednesday has left three people wounded.

The fight started on a northbound number 1 train as it pulled into the 110th Street station just before 5 p.m. The scuffle then spilled out onto the platform.

Police say two people were slashed and one was beaten with a cane. The injuries were not considered life-threatening.

"I was in my car and I heard screaming ... from downstairs ... bunch of boys ran out and then this other guy ran up," an eyewitness told us.

It is not clear what sparked the fight. Police have made no arrests.
